Second year of the TXI. Odd one-spoke steering wheel. Good boat though. In 15 they moved the engine forward, switched to PCM motors, changed the throttle lever and steering wheel for the better. I think all of those first gen TXIs were great but 15-16 are definitely better.

I have a 2013 TXi. Overall it has been a fantastic boat. great wake, ZO, plenty of power. For the 2011-15 I don't think there were major changes year to year. I've heard in 15 or maybe 16 about moving the engine more forward. Honestly the boat tracks well, has a great wake. Plenty of space and higher side board so less water over the bow. The steering wheel is a little strange but not a deal breaker. The throttle is very sensitive, small movements make big changes but once the skier is up and you are around the island, does it matter? The unique single post steering wheel was explained to me as: The 'heavy on purpose design' post would act as a rudder straightener thus acting like added caster on an automobile. 2016 was the engine move, there is a thread on this site that Chad Scott discussed the effects.
